## Changelog — Gateway 5.1.0 (key rotation)

For the weekly eng sync: this release rotates the signing key used by the Corvane internal API gateway after we tightened rate limiting. The new token-bucket config (burst 50, refill 10/s per caller) shipped alongside, so expect 429s from previously unthrottled batch jobs. All gateway config bundles must now be re-signed before publish; unsigned bundles are rejected at load. The rotated key, effective immediately for all environments, appears below.

rollout seal: bky4_x7Gc

## Auth

Integration tests for Payrail hit the sandbox ledger, not prod. Flakes are almost always auth-related: the sandbox rotates session certs nightly at 03:00 UTC, and any test started before rotation but finishing after will 401. Retry once before filing anything. Don't use personal tokens — they lack the ledger-write scope and fail silently. All CI runs authenticate against the Sandvault token broker with the shared test key below.

gateway credential: kto23_LX9A4ys6i4nzHtpOLNLodKK

Changelog — GalleryWhisper v3.4.1

Rotated the release signing key for the GalleryWhisper audio-guide app after the old key passed its scheduled expiry. All tour bundles for the Verrandale Museum build now verify against the new key; older bundles remain valid until the grace window closes next month. If you're setting up a fresh build environment, configure your signer with the key below.

release key, hadug-kawef: bky13_mPGeFZeR1GZ1G

Reviewer: confirm the delimiter-detection config matches staging before approving. Build artifact must come from the tagged release pipeline — reject anything built locally. Check that the dry-run import against the sample tenant produced zero row errors and that header-mapping migrations applied cleanly. Promotion requires a signed manifest; the gateway drops unsigned manifests without logging, so a missing signature looks like a stalled deploy. Approve only after the manifest is signed with the key below.

signing key of kagaf-kawif = bky9_TUKEcBvKn